Oil Moguls Emerge as Key Cash Source for Trump as Race Nears End: Analyzing the Financial Implications

In recent news, it has been reported that oil moguls are stepping up as significant financial backers for Donald Trump's campaign as the presidential race approaches its climax. This development is noteworthy not only for its political implications but also for its potential impact on the financial markets. In this article, we will analyze the short-term and long-term effects of this news and provide insights into the stocks, indices, and futures that may be affected.

Short-Term Impacts on Financial Markets

1. Energy Stocks Rally: The immediate reaction in the stock market could see energy stocks, particularly those in the oil sector, experience a surge. Companies such as Exxon Mobil Corporation (XOM) and Chevron Corporation (CVX) may see increased investor interest due to the close ties between their operations and Trump's energy policies. The prospect of favorable regulations and support for fossil fuels can lead to a bullish sentiment in these stocks.

2. Political Risk Premium: The financial markets may incorporate a political risk premium reflecting the uncertainty surrounding election outcomes. If investors perceive that Trump's policies will benefit the oil industry, there may be a temporary spike in oil prices, influenced by speculative trading. This could impact the Crude Oil WTI Futures (CL), leading to increased volatility.

3. Sector Rotation: Investors may shift their focus towards sectors that are likely to benefit from a pro-oil administration. Indices such as the S&P 500 Energy Sector ETF (XLE) may see an uptick as funds flow into energy-related equities.

Long-Term Impacts on Financial Markets

1. Policy Implications: If Trump were to win the election, his administration's policies could significantly affect regulations surrounding oil drilling, environmental protections, and energy independence. This could lead to a more favorable operating environment for oil companies, potentially resulting in long-term stock appreciation in the energy sector.

2. Sustainable Energy Sector: Conversely, the increased backing from oil moguls could also lead to a backlash from environmentally focused investors. This may foster a long-term shift toward sustainable energy investments, impacting companies in the renewable sector like NextEra Energy, Inc. (NEE) and First Solar, Inc. (FSLR).

3. Market Volatility: The financial markets could experience heightened volatility as uncertainty around the election could lead to fluctuating investor sentiment. Historical events, such as the 2016 U.S. Presidential election, demonstrated similar market behaviors where sectors impacted by the outcomes experienced sharp movements.

Historical Context

Looking back at the 2016 U.S. Presidential election, energy stocks saw a significant rally post-election due to the market's favorable view of Trump’s pro-fossil fuel policies. On November 9, 2016, the S&P 500 Energy Sector gained approximately 5.4% in the days following the election results. This historical precedent may provide a framework for anticipating market behavior in response to current events.
